How much does decorative stone and rock usually cost in West North Carolina (Dallas, NC)?

Typical retail ranges for decorative stone in West North Carolina are about $40 to $120 per ton depending on type (pea gravel at the low end, specialty colored stone at the high end). Using an average conversion of about 1 cubic yard ≈ 1.3 tons, that works out to roughly $50 to $160 per cubic yard. Prices vary by material, color, and local supply, so check your zip code for exact quotes.

What should I expect to pay to install decorative stone for driveways, patios, and pathways in a small town like Dallas?

Installed costs vary by scope: a simple decorative top layer for a driveway can run about $3 to $7 per square foot, while a properly built gravel driveway with base and compaction may cost $6 to $12 per square foot. Patio and pathway installations typically range $5 to $15 per square foot depending on edging, base prep, and labor. DIY projects are cheaper but still require base prep and drainage planning.

Which decorative stone types work best for Dallas' climate and terrain?

For Dallas and the surrounding West North Carolina/Piedmont region, crushed stone or crushed granite is preferred for driveways because they lock and compact well. Pea gravel and river rock are popular for walkways, garden accents, and dry creek beds due to good drainage and appearance. Choose the material based on use: durable, angular stone for traffic areas versus rounded river rock for aesthetics and drainage.

How many tons or cubic yards of decorative stone do I need for common projects in Dallas?

Use these typical estimates: a single-car driveway (12'x20') at 3u0022 depth needs about 2.2 cubic yards (≈ 2.9 tons); a double-car driveway (20'x40') at 3u0022 needs about 7.4 cubic yards (≈ 9.6 tons); a 12'x12' patio at 2u0022 needs about 0.9 cubic yards (≈ 1.2 tons); a 100 sq ft garden bed at 2u0022 needs about 0.6 cubic yards (≈ 0.8 tons). Do local contractors in West North Carolina recommend landscape fabric under decorative stone?

Contractor practices vary, but many local pros use a permeable geotextile fabric under stone to suppress weeds while allowing water to drain, especially for decorative beds and pathways. For driveways, contractors often prefer a proper compacted base and edge restraint first, then fabric only where needed; some avoid fabric in high-traffic areas because it can trap fines and affect compaction. Ask your installer about their approach for your specific material and slope.

How does decorative stone handle heavy rain, erosion, and occasional winter weather in Dallas?

In the Piedmont region, properly installed decorative stone with compacted base, edge restraints, and good slope will drain well and resist washout. Rounded materials like pea gravel can migrate on slopes in heavy rains, so use edging or larger rock for slope control; crushed stone with fines locks together better against erosion. Winter snow and ice are usually minor in Dallas; stone itself is unaffected, but pay attention to drainage and avoid using excessive sand or salt that can discolor certain decorative stones.

Any practical tips for choosing decorative stone in Dallas neighborhoods?

Match stone color and size to your home's style and the local landscape—lighter stones brighten shady yards, while warmer tones complement brick homes common in the Piedmont. Consider maintenance: smaller rounded stones need occasional topping and edging, while angular crushed stone stays put better under traffic.
